  8. #8
    You can engrave brass with your laser. Here is a photo of a brass bussiness card I engraved for a customer yesterday. This was using LMM-14
    Attached Images Attached Images

  9. #9

    Very nice

    Did you use anything special on the brass, or did you just engrave it as is?

  10. #10
    The only thing I did was spray with the LMM-14. I engraved at 63 speed 100 power 400 dpi. This is a 100 watt laser.
